Did you know that not all tattoos are created equal? The ink used in tattoos can vary significantly based on color and brand. Dark colors like black are easier to remove compared to lighter hues such as yellow or green. Understanding this can greatly influence your tattoo removal journey.
Your skin type can play a significant role in how effectively a tattoo can be removed. For instance, fair skin often responds better to laser treatments than darker skin types due to contrasts in pigmentation.
Laser tattoo removal is considered one of the most effective methods available today. This technique utilizes high-intensity light beams that target pigment particles within the ink.

The number of sessions required for complete removal varies widely—anywhere from 5-15 sessions—depending on several factors including ink color and density.
Dermabrasion involves physically exfoliating the top layers of skin where the tattoo resides. While effective for some tattoos, this method can lead to scarring if not done correctly.
Chemical peels use acidic solutions to break down ink pigments over time but may require multiple treatments and are generally less effective than laser options.

After undergoing any form of tattoo removal treatment—especially laser therapy—proper aftercare is vital for healing without complications.
Patients should avoid sun exposure or vigorous physical activity immediately following their sessions for optimal healing.
